Specifications

System

Laser: Semiconductor laser

λ = 780 nm for CD

λ = 650 nm for Super Audio CD and
DVD
Emission duration: continuous

Signal format system: NTSC

Audio characteristics

Frequency response: DVD VIDEO (PCM

96 kHz): 2 Hz to 44 kHz (44 kHz: –2 dB
±1 dB), Super Audio CD: 2 Hz to
100 kHz (40 kHz: –3 dB ±1 dB), CD:
2 Hz to 20 kHz (±0.5 dB)

Signal-to-noise ratio (S/N ratio): 100 dB

(AUDIO OUT L/R 1/2 jacks only)

Harmonic distortion: Super Audio CD:

0.0025 %, CD: 0.0028 %,

Dynamic range: DVD VIDEO/Super Audio

CD: 103 dB, CD: 99 dB

Wow and flutter: Less than detected value

(±0.001% W PEAK)

Outputs

(Jack name: Jack type/Output level/Load

impedance)

AUDIO OUT L/R 1/2: Phono jack/2 Vrms/

10 kilohms

DIGITAL OUT (OPTICAL): Optical

output jack/–18 dBm (wave length:
660 nm)

DIGITAL OUT (COAXIAL): Phono jack/

0.5 Vp-p/75 ohms

HDMI OUT: TypeA (19 pin)
5.1CH OUTPUT: Phono jack/2 Vrms/

10 kilohms

General

Power requirements:

120 V AC, 60 Hz

Power consumption: 27 W
Dimensions (approx.): 430

Ч 115 Ч 375 mm

Mass (approx.): 5.5 kg (12 lb 2 oz)
